One More Day

Tomorrow Walt Disney World will begin Cast Member previews, with AP previews beginning on the 9th and the general public being welcomed back on the 11th. Living in a pandemic stricken world, I will never again take for granted that the parks will be open, and of course they could shut down again as easily as they are opening back up.

But I will feel much better tomorrow knowing that someone somewhere is enjoying a spin on the teacups, devouring a churro, taking a safari through Africa, or flying over Pandora.
